What Is Emotional Abuse?
Emotional abuse involves abusive behavior that causes psychological or mental trauma. Emotional abuse does not require physical harm. Emotional abuse can involve threats of harm, bullying, isolation, exposure to violence, and neglect. Emotional abuse is common in cases of child abuse and domestic violence.
What Are Some Examples of Emotional Abuse Situations Where I Might Need a Family Law Attorney?
Victims of emotional abuse may not know their abuser is committing a crime. Some emotional abuse, such as threats of violence, is criminal, even if it does not cause physical harm. What Are the Top Questions When Choosing a Family Law Lawyer?
These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able and confident that a lawyer has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case well. Many family law lawyers offer free consultations that allow you to underst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. The top questions include:
- What is your experience in family law?
- Are you familiar with Chicago and Illinois courts and judges?
- Have you managed cases like mine before?
- How do you manage potential conflicts of interest?
- What are the potential outcomes of my case?
- What is your fees and billing structure?
- How involved will I be in strategy decisions about the case?
